A000298 Number of partitions into non-integral powers.
(Formerly M3439 N1395)
+0
2
1, 4, 12, 30, 70, 159, 339, 706, 1436, 2853, 5551, 10622, 19975 (list; graph; listen)
OFFSET

1,2

COMMENT

a(n) is the number of solutions to the inequality sum_{i=1,2,..} x_i^(1/2)<=n for unknowns 1<=x_1<x_2<x_3<x_4<.... [From R. J. Mathar (mathar(AT)strw.leidenuniv.nl), Jul 03 2009]

EXAMPLE

The 12 solutions for n=3 are 1^(1/2)<=3, 1^(1/2)+2^(1/2)<=3, 1^(1/2)+3^(1/2)<=3, 1^(1/2)+4^(1/2)<=3, 2^(1/2)<=3, 3^(1/2)<=3,...,8^(1/2)<=3 and 9^(1/2)<=3. [From R. J. Mathar (mathar(AT)strw.leidenuniv.nl), Jul 03 2009]
